1. Shelter and Protection

In birdhouse dreams, the symbolism of shelter and protection is a recurring theme. The birdhouse acts as a refuge, providing a safe haven for the birds and symbolizing a need for security and protection in the dreamer’s life.

Shelter: The birdhouse represents a place of safety and protection, both for the birds and for the dreamer themselves. Just as birds seek shelter in a birdhouse, the dreamer may be seeking a sense of security in their waking life. This could be related to physical, emotional, or psychological aspects.

Protection: The birdhouse also symbolizes the need for protection. Birds instinctively seek out safe spaces to nest and raise their young without fear for their safety. Similarly, the dreamer may be longing for protection and a sense of security in their own life. This could be a desire for protection from external threats or a need for emotional support and stability.

The symbolism of shelter and protection in birdhouse dreams can also be seen as a message from the subconscious mind. It may be encouraging the dreamer to seek out safe spaces and surround themselves with people or environments that provide a sense of security.

It is important to note that the interpretation of birdhouse dreams can vary depending on the specific details and context of the dream. For example, if the birdhouse is damaged or destroyed, it could suggest a sense of vulnerability or a feeling of being unprotected in the waking life. Conversely, if the birdhouse is portrayed as strong and well-maintained, it may indicate a strong support system and a sense of security in the dreamer’s life.

The symbolism of shelter and protection in birdhouse dreams signifies a deep need for security, both physically and emotionally, and emphasizes the importance of creating a safe and protective environment in the dreamer’s waking life.

2. Creating a Safe Haven

Creating a Safe Haven

In the realm of dream symbolism, birdhouses often represent creating a safe haven. When we dream of birdhouses, it can signify our desire to establish a secure and protected space for ourselves and those around us. This symbolizes the inherent human need for safety and comfort in our lives.

A birdhouse is a small, enclosed structure that provides shelter and protection for birds. Similarly, in our dreams, it represents our desire to create a sanctuary where we can feel safe and secure from the outside world. This safe haven can be both physical and emotional, encompassing elements such as a stable home, supportive relationships, or a peaceful state of mind.

Within the context of dream interpretation, the idea of creating a safe haven can be explored in various scenarios and contexts. For example, a dream where you discover or stumble upon a birdhouse may represent an unconscious desire for security and protection in your waking life.

Dream Scenario 1: You find yourself wandering through a forest and stumble upon a beautifully crafted birdhouse nestled among the trees. The sight of the birdhouse fills you with a sense of peace and tranquility, as if you have found a safe haven amidst the chaos of the world.

In this scenario, the birdhouse symbolizes the yearning for a safe and peaceful space where you can retreat from the challenges and uncertainties of life. It suggests the need for creating such an environment in your waking life, where you can find solace and rejuvenation.

Another way in which the concept of a safe haven can manifest in birdhouse dreams is through the act of building or constructing a birdhouse. This represents the active process of creating a secure and nurturing environment for yourself and those around you.

Dream Scenario 2: You find yourself engaged in the process of building a birdhouse from scratch. You carefully select the materials, design the structure, and assemble it with great care and attention to detail. As you complete the birdhouse, you feel a deep sense of satisfaction and accomplishment.

In this scenario, the act of building the birdhouse symbolizes your proactive efforts to establish a safe haven in your waking life. It suggests that you are taking the necessary steps to create a sense of security and protection for yourself and those you care about. It may also reflect your nurturing and caring nature, as you invest time and energy into creating a space of warmth and comfort.

Creating a safe haven through a birdhouse dream can also extend beyond the boundaries of physical spaces and relationships. It can represent the need for emotional safety and security within oneself. Just as birds seek shelter and protection in a birdhouse, we too seek emotional refuge in times of distress or vulnerability.

Dream Scenario 3: You dream of sitting inside a birdhouse, feeling protected and secure. The walls of the birdhouse provide a shield from the outside world, allowing you to feel at ease and free from any worries or fears.

This scenario symbolizes the need to find emotional sanctuary within yourself. The dream is reassuring you that you possess the inner strength and resources to create a safe haven within your own mind and heart. It encourages self-care, self-love, and self-compassion as essential elements in establishing a lasting sense of security and well-being.

Creating a safe haven in birdhouse dreams signifies the importance of finding a space where we can let our guards down, relax, and recharge. It reminds us to prioritize our own well-being and emotional needs, as well as those of others, in order to cultivate a sense of safety and stability in our lives.

With the understanding that dreams are highly personal and subjective experiences, it is crucial to consider the specific emotions and details present in the dream in order to gain a more accurate interpretation of the symbolism of creating a safe haven through birdhouse dreams.

3. Nurturing and Caring for Others

In dream symbolism, a birdhouse can represent nurturing and caring for others. Just as a birdhouse provides a safe and comfortable home for birds, dreaming of a birdhouse can indicate your instinctual need to provide care and support to those around you. This dream may be a reflection of your natural inclination to nurture and protect others, whether it be family members, friends, or even strangers in need.

The birdhouse in your dream serves as a metaphor for the nurturing qualities that you possess. It symbolizes your ability to create a safe and nurturing environment for others to thrive in. Just as birds rely on a birdhouse for shelter and protection, people may depend on you for guidance, support, and emotional nourishment.

This dream may also suggest that you have a strong desire to care for and nurture others. It could be a reflection of your need to take on a role of a caregiver or protector. You might have an innate sense of responsibility towards others and derive great satisfaction from assisting and comforting those in need.

Additionally, dreaming of a birdhouse can signify your connection with nature and your appreciation for the world around you. Birds are often seen as symbols of freedom and harmony with nature. They represent a sense of peace and tranquility. Dreaming of a birdhouse indicates that you value the beauty and serenity that nature has to offer and that you find solace in being connected to the natural world.

It is important to note that the specific details of your dream, such as the condition of the birdhouse, the type of birds inhabiting it, and your interactions with the birds, can provide further insight into the symbolic meaning. These details may reveal specific aspects of nurturing and caring for others that are particularly relevant to your life circumstances.
